Choosing the Right Shape and Material
A round coffee table’s curvature invites conversation and circulation. Opt for materials like reclaimed wood for warmth, glass for lightness, or metal for modern edge. Ensure the diameter fits the room—typically 48 to 66 inches—and choose a sturdy base to enhance durability without sacrificing style.
Lighting and Accessorizing for Impact
Strategic lighting elevates a round coffee table. Pair it with a sleek floor lamp or string lights overhead to create depth. Add texture with throw pillows, a woven rug, or a sculptural vase. Avoid clutter—let the circular silhouette remain the focal point.
Harmonizing with Room Aesthetics
Coordinate with existing decor: a mid-century modern table complements bold patterns, while a minimalist design suits Scandinavian interiors. Balance scale and color—neutral tones unify spaces, while a pop of hue adds personality. Ensure harmony between the table and surrounding furniture.
